Partager via


macro TreeView_GetItemRect (commctrl.h)

Récupère le rectangle englobant d’un élément d’arborescence et indique si l’élément est visible. Vous pouvez utiliser cette macro ou envoyer explicitement le message TVM_GETITEMRECT.

Syntaxe

BOOL TreeView_GetItemRect(
   HWND      hwnd,
   HTREEITEM hitem,
   LPRECT    prc,
   BOOL      code
);

Paramètres

hwnd

Type : HWND

Gérez le contrôle d’arborescence.

hitem

Type : HTREEITEM

Gérer l’élément d’arborescence.

prc

Type : LPRECT

Pointeur vers une structure RECT qui reçoit le rectangle englobant. Les coordonnées sont relatives au coin supérieur gauche du contrôle d’arborescence.

code

Type : BOOL

Valeur spécifiant la partie de l’élément pour laquelle récupérer le rectangle englobant. Si ce paramètre est TRUE, le rectangle englobant inclut uniquement le texte de l’élément. Sinon, elle inclut la ligne entière occupée par l’élément dans le contrôle tree-view.

Valeur de retour

Type : BOOL

Si l’élément est visible et que le rectangle englobant est récupéré avec succès, la valeur de retour est TRUE. Sinon, le message TVM_GETITEMRECT retourne FAUX et ne récupère pas le rectangle englobant.

Exigences

Exigence Valeur
client minimum pris en charge Windows Vista [applications de bureau uniquement]
serveur minimum pris en charge Windows Server 2003 [applications de bureau uniquement]
plateforme cible Windows
d’en-tête commctrl.h